Introducing: The Oris Pointer Date Heritage

March 21, 2018

The Oris Big Crown Pointer Date has always been a great daily wearer, and this year it is back in a smaller case and with a selection of new dial colors. The watch is now available in either 36mm or 40mm case sizes, both in stainless steel and with a leather strap or a steel bracelet. The dial is the same one you know and love C with Arabic numerals, Cathedral hands, and third hand pointing to the outer date ring (no date windows!) C but the colors were chosen from Le Corbusier's Polychromie architecurale, with a light green option for the 36mm version, a blue-grey option for the 40mm version, and a black option for both. The watches are still powered by the caliber 654, which is based on a Selita SW200-1.? Initial Thoughts As I mentioned, the Oris Big Crown Pointer Date has always been a crowd favorite, and adding another case size with interesting dial colors is a good move on Oris's part. Another reason that this watch is so popular is the price point. Both the 36mm and the 40mm versions of this watch are priced under $2,000, which is still a chunk of change but slightly more achievable for those wanting a substantial watch with a cool history.? The Basics Brand: OrisModel: Big Crown Pointer DateReference Number: 01 754 7749 4064 / 4067 MBDiameter: 36mm or 40mmCase Material: Stainless steelDial Color: Light Green (36mm), Blue-Grey (40mm), or Black (both)Indexes: Arabic numeralsLume: Super-LumiNova on hands and markersStrap/Bracelet: Leather strap or stainless steel bracelet The Movement Caliber: Oris 754 (based on the Sellita SW 200-1)Functions: Hours, minutes, seconds, and dateDiameter: 25.6mmPower Reserve: 38 hoursWinding: AutomaticFrequency: 4 Hz (28,800 vph)Jewels: 26 Pricing & Availability Price: CHF 1,550 (strap), CHF 1,750 (bracelet)Availability: TBDFor more, click here.
